Output 575a6a406c4ef17a0769a8e4a344eb84661a9620ee808c5dddbd1f38cf161e99:30

value
454308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baeea41c926df4b54656ac6220e05e5c45371ba1 OP_EQUAL
address
3JjRVJ7NXYs8B6p1NJirZ7fkgy1u1WWtoV
transaction
575a6a406c4ef17a0769a8e4a344eb84661a9620ee808c5dddbd1f38cf161e99
spent
true